Code P1BFF Buick Description

This is an internal fault detection of the auxiliary transmission fluid pump control module. The modules listed below are internal to the power inverter module and are not serviced separately. These faults are handled inside the hybrid powertrain control module and no external circuits are involved.

What are the Possible Causes of the DTC P1BFF Buick?

  • Faulty Auxiliary Transmission Fluid Pump Motor Control Module
  • Auxiliary Transmission Fluid Pump Motor Control Module harness is open or shorted
  • Auxiliary Transmission Fluid Pump Motor Control Module circuit poor electrical connection

How to Fix the DTC P1BFF Buick?

Review the 'Possible Causes' above and visually examine the corresponding wiring harness and connectors. Check for damaged components and inspect connector pins for signs of being broken, bent, pushed out, or corroded.

What is the Cost to Diagnose the Code?

Labor: 1.0

To diagnose the P1BFF Buick code, it typically requires 1.0 hour of labor. Rates vary by location, vehicle, and shop. Many shops charge between $80–$150 per hour; dealerships and metro areas may be higher, independents may be lower.
